WebDec 13, 2024 · FSH works closely with the other gonadotrophin, LH, to produce sperm in the testes. Because of this role, a complete absence of FSH can lead to infertility through a lack of sperm (azoospermia). If there is a deficient FSH level, the result could be limited sperm production, but becoming a father could still be possible.
